Yoga Breathworks wants to encourage your curiosity about the mind body connection through yoga. The idea that stress impacts our health is not new, gradually we are realising we all have agency, we can down-regulate our overstimulated nervous systems & prevent dis-ease in the body. Breathing techniques (pranayama) & body awareness (asana) meditation (nidra & sound healing) help reduce stress, ease discomfort, improve sleep, prevent injuries, and enhance resilience.

Hatha sparked my interest in yoga in my teens, leading me to Astanga Vinyasa in 1998, I was totally hooked on practicing daily & on the feeling of happiness that the demanding 2 hr practise gave.
Yoga stayed with me, in gyms & village halls, on holidays & work trips, providing health & wellbeing through life’s journey.
In 2011 Nick & I built a photography studio for our businesses: HelenMarsdenphotography.com & MarMarCreative.com behind our house.
I quickly realised the space was fantastic for yoga & invited local yoga teachers to hire the space regularly. I knew then Teacher Training was a long term goal. Studying the history, philosophy, anatomy, physiology & sequencing of yoga was a fascinating deep dive into a life long passion. I was taught by well respected, experienced & varied teachers who shared their many contrasting viewpoints. I’v continued my learning journey with YTT500 & recently into Sound Healing.
Ultimately these practices help to balance life’s contrasts, strength with flexibility, movement towards stillness, symmetry & asymmetry, deep focus followed & relaxation. By combining dynamic movement with stillness, we promote fitness & injury prevention, work towards calm, mental clarity & develop ease in facing life’s challenges.
I teach Vinyasa, Yin & Chair yoga & Yoga Nidra & Sound because I have & continue to find that it all helps soften & down regulate the stresses of modern life.
